The Science Behind the Stars

The study of stars, known as stellar astronomy, is a key branch of astrophysics. Stars are monolithic, lucent spheres of plasma held together by their own gravity. They give energy through nuclear fusion, converting hydrogen into helium and unloosen vast amounts of energy in the procedure. This energy radiates outward, illuminating the cosmos and ply the light that guides us Upon A Starlit Tide.

Stars get in respective sizes, colors, and stages of evolution. The most mutual type of star is the main sequence star, which includes our own Sun. These stars fuse hydrogen into helium in their cores and are comparatively stable over long periods. Other types of stars include red giants, white dwarfs, and neutron stars, each with its unique characteristics and life cycle.

One of the most intrigue aspects of stellar astronomy is the study of stellar evolution. Stars are born from clouds of gas and dust, known as nebulae, and go through various stages of development before finally dying. The death of a star can be a spectacular event, ensue in phenomena such as supernovae, which release enormous amounts of energy and create new elements that enrich the universe.

Exploring the Depths of Space

Beyond the stars, the universe is fill with a myriad of other celestial objects and phenomena. Galaxies, nebulae, black holes, and exoplanets are just a few examples of the wonders that await exploration. The concept of Upon A Starlit Tide extends to these deeper realms of space, where scientists and explorers seek to uncover the mysteries of the cosmos.

Galaxies are vast collections of stars, gas, dust, and dark matter held together by gravity. Our own Milky Way galaxy is just one of hundreds of billions of galaxies in the observable universe. Each galaxy has its unique structure and characteristics, stray from spiral galaxies like the Milky Way to elliptical and irregular galaxies.

Nebulae are clouds of gas and dust where new stars are born. These interstellar clouds can be clear by nearby stars, creating stun visual displays. Some of the most noted nebulae include the Orion Nebula, the Eagle Nebula, and the Crab Nebula. Each nebula offers insights into the processes of star formation and the early stages of stellar evolution.

Black holes are regions of space where the gravitative pull is so strong that nothing, not even light, can escape. These enigmatic objects form from the collapse of massive stars and can have a profound impact on their surrounding environment. Black holes are frequently found at the centers of galaxies, including our own Milky Way, and play a all-important role in the dynamics of galactic phylogenesis.

Exoplanets are planets that orbit stars outside our solar system. The discovery of exoplanets has revolutionise our understanding of planetary systems and the potential for life beyond Earth. Techniques such as the transit method and radial velocity method have enabled astronomers to detect thousands of exoplanets, revealing a diverse range of erratic types and orbits.

The Impact of Light Pollution

While the stars have always been a source of admiration and inspiration, their profile is progressively threatened by light befoulment. The concept of Upon A Starlit Tide highlights the importance of continue the night sky for future generations. Light pollution, caused by excessive artificial lighting, can obscure the stars and disrupt the natural rhythms of the environment.

Light pollution affects not only our power to see the stars but also the health of ecosystems and human well being. Artificial light can disrupt the sleep patterns of animals and plants, leading to ecological imbalances. For humans, excessive light at night can interfere with sleep and contribute to health issues such as obesity and slump.

To mitigate the effects of light contamination, it is essential to promote creditworthy illuminate practices. This includes using energy efficient alight, aim light downward to understate sky glow, and reducing unneeded lighting. By direct these steps, we can help preserve the beauty of the night sky and check that futurity generations can experience the wonder of Upon A Starlit Tide.

One of the most efficacious ways to combat light befoulment is through public awareness and education. Organizations such as the International Dark Sky Association (IDA) work to elevate awareness about the impacts of light contamination and elevate solutions. By back these efforts, we can assist protect the night sky and the natural reality.

besides public sentience, technical advancements can play a role in reduce light pollution. Innovations such as smart lighting systems and adaptative lighting can facilitate minimize the wallop of stilted light on the environment. These technologies use sensors and algorithms to adjust illuminate levels based on real time conditions, ensuring that light is used efficiently and responsibly.

Another important aspect of combating light befoulment is the assignment of dark sky reserves and parks. These protected areas are designated to preserve the natural iniquity of the night sky and render opportunities for stargaze and astronomy. By endorse these initiatives, we can help ensure that the wonders of the cosmos remain approachable to future generations.
